RECOMMENDED SEPARATION DISTANCES
Table 18. Recommended Separation Distances between Portable and Mobile RF Communications
Equipment and the System
The system is intended for use in an electromagnetic environment in which radiated RF disturbances are
controlled. The customer or the user of the system can help prevent electromagnetic interference by
maintaining a minimum distance between portable and mobile RF communications equipment (transmitters)
and the system as recommended below, according to the maximum output power of the communications
equipment.
RATED MAXIMUM
OUTPUT POWER OF
TRANSMITTER (W)
SEPARATION DISTANCE ACCORDING TO FREQUENCY OF TRANSMITTER (m)
150 kHz to 80 MHz
d=1.2P
80 MHz to 800 MHz
d=1.2P
800 MHz to 2.5 GHz
d=2.3P
0.01 0.12 0.12 0.23
0.1 0.38 0.38 0.73
1 1.2 1.2 2.3
10 3.8 3.8 7.3
100 12 12 23
For transmitters rated at a maximum output power not listed above, the recommended separation distance d
in meters (m) can be estimated using the equation applicable to the frequency of the transmitter, where P is
the maximum output power rating of the transmitter in watts (W) according to the transmitter manufacturer.
Note: At 80 MHz and 800 MHz, the separation distance for the higher frequency range applies.
These guidelines may not apply in all situations. Electromagnetic propagation is affected by absorption and
reflection from structures, objects and people.
ACCESSORY CONFORMANCE TO STANDARDS
To maintain electromagnetic interference (EMI) within certified limits, the system must be used with the
cables, components, and accessories specified or supplied by Verathon
®
. For additional information, see the
System Parts & Accessories and Component Specifications sections. The use of accessories or cables other
than those specified or supplied may result in increased emissions or decreased immunity of the system.
